URBAN PLANNING • DESIGN • MARKET EARCH MEMORANDUM e, /,,, . ~; -4- 61- 4L Pt y��_.1 TO: LaVonne Wilson /Iv FROM: Curtis Gutoske DATE: 17 April 1990 RE : Oak Park Heights - Rapid Oil Change FILE NO: 798 . 02 - 89 . 08 A revised landscape plan for the new Rapid Oil Change development has been submitted to our office in response to the City Council ' s directive ( see 30 March 1990 NAC letter) . A copy of this plan is attached. Review of the revised plan reveals the amount of landscaping has been increased to conform with the Ordinance (although at a minimum level) . In addition, the sizes and types of plantings proposed also meet Ordinance requirements . It should be noted, however, that the description for the Common Junipers around the pylon sign and the northwest corner of the building should he JCS-12 rather than JCS-6 . This is to reflect six plantings to be installed at each location. It should also be required that a wood or rock mulch be installed in each planting bed to control weed growth and provide for the proper maintenance of the landscaping. Given these comments, our office finds the revised landscaping plan acceptable and we recommend its implementation. As a related matter regarding this development, it has been noticed as recently as 7 April 1990 that continuous concrete curbing has yet to be installed around the perimeter of the parking lot and driveway surfaces . I did, however, witness concrete tire stops lined up on the west side of the parking lot, although this does not satisfy the Ordinance requirement nor the previous site plans ( see second Exhibit) . You may wish to have the Building Official check on this matter to ensure .that concrete curbing is to be installed. The Developer shall be responsible for maintaining the location of and protecting curb stops, water services and sewer services . Any service or curb stop damaged shall be repaired or replaced as specified by the City. The Developer shall make all necessary adjustments to the curb stops to bring them flush with the topsoil (after grading) or driveway surface. E. The Developer shall be required to provide landscaping and screening as determined by the City and as required by the ordinances of the City. F. The Developer shall remove all dead and diseased trees before building permits will be issued. G. The Developer shall be responsible for street maintenance, including curbs, boulevards, sod and street sweeping until the project is complete. The repair of any damage done to the streets or public utilities shall be the financial responsibility of the Developer . H. The Developer shall pay to City the sum of $1,750 .00 per acre to the park fund in lieu of any park dedication. M. The Developer shall be responsible for securing all necessary approvals and permits from all appropriate federal, state, regional and local jurisdictions prior to the commencement of site grading or construction and prior to the City awarding construction contracts for public utilities. 2.
